Step-by-Step Guide for Setting Up Broadband Internet
- Choose a suitable broadband plan from a reputable provider based on your internet usage requirements.
- Set up your modem by connecting it to the main telephone line or cable outlet in your home.
- Connect your router to the modem using an Ethernet cable to enable wireless internet access.
- Configure your Wi-Fi network settings, including network name (SSID) and password, for security purposes.
- Place your router in a central location in your home to ensure optimal Wi-Fi coverage throughout the house.

Equipment Required for New Home Network Setup
- Modem: Connects your home to the internet service provider.
- Router: Distributes the internet connection wirelessly to devices in your home.
- Ethernet cables: Used to connect the modem, router, and devices for a stable wired connection.
Tips for Optimizing Wi-Fi Coverage and Network Security
- Position your router in a central location away from obstructions and interference for better Wi-Fi coverage.
- Enable WPA2 encryption on your Wi-Fi network and regularly update the password for enhanced security.
- Consider using Wi-Fi extenders or mesh systems to boost signal strength in larger homes with multiple floors.

Software Computer Forensics
Computer forensics is a branch of digital forensic science that involves the investigation and analysis of digital evidence to solve crimes. It plays a crucial role in uncovering cybercrimes and gathering evidence for legal proceedings.Software tools are essential in computer forensics investigations as they help in extracting, preserving, and analyzing digital evidence from various devices such as computers, smartphones, and storage media.
These tools enable forensic experts to recover deleted files, examine internet history, and identify potential sources of intrusion.
Popular Computer Forensics Software Tools
- EnCase: A widely used tool for forensic analysis, EnCase allows investigators to acquire data, conduct analysis, and generate reports to present in court.
- FTK (Forensic Toolkit): FTK is known for its powerful search and indexing capabilities, making it ideal for scanning large volumes of data efficiently.
- Sleuth Kit: An open-source tool that provides a range of forensic analysis features, including file system analysis, searching, and timeline analysis.
- Autopsy: Another open-source platform, Autopsy offers a user-friendly interface for analyzing disk images and recovering files, emails, and other digital artifacts.
Broadband Internet
Broadband internet technology has evolved significantly over the years, offering faster and more reliable connections to users. It allows for high-speed data transmission, enabling seamless streaming, online gaming, video conferencing, and more.
Types of Broadband Connections
- DSL (Digital Subscriber Line): Utilizes telephone lines to transmit data, offering decent speeds but can be affected by distance from the provider’s central office.
- Cable: Uses coaxial cables to deliver internet service, providing fast speeds and widespread availability, but bandwidth can be shared with other users in the area.
- Fiber: Employs fiber-optic cables for data transmission, offering the fastest speeds and most reliable connection, but availability is limited in some areas.
- Satellite: Ideal for remote locations, satellite internet connects users through satellites in orbit, but can be affected by weather conditions and latency issues.
Advantages and Disadvantages
- DSL: Affordable and widely available, but speeds may vary depending on location.
- Cable: Fast speeds and widespread availability, but performance can be impacted during peak hours due to shared bandwidth.
- Fiber: Offers the fastest speeds and most reliable connection, but may not be available in all areas and can be more expensive.
- Satellite: Suitable for remote areas, but can be affected by weather conditions and has higher latency compared to other types of connections.

How Satellite TV Works
- Satellite TV works by transmitting signals from a satellite in space to a satellite dish installed at the viewer’s location.
- The satellite dish receives the signals and sends them to a receiver box, which decodes the signals and displays them on the TV screen.
- Advantages of Satellite TV:
– Wide range of channels and programming options
– Better signal quality and reception compared to cable TV
– Availability in remote or rural areas where cable services may not reach

Hardware Components for Satellite Radio
- Satellite Radio Receiver: This is the main hardware component required to pick up satellite radio signals. It is usually a small device that can be installed in your home or car.
- Antenna: A satellite radio antenna is necessary to capture the satellite signals and transmit them to the receiver. The antenna should be placed in an area with a clear line of sight to the sky for optimal reception.
- Mounting Hardware: Depending on where you plan to install the satellite radio hardware, you may need mounting hardware such as brackets or stands to secure the receiver and antenna in place.
